Sprachunterricht heute (Language Teaching Today) by Horst Bartnitzky is a foundational academic guide widely used in German teacher education. It provides a comprehensive methodology for teaching German in primary schools, focusing on an integrated, "integrative" approach rather than teaching grammar, spelling, and literature in isolation. Core Concepts of Bartnitzky’s Guide

Situational Learning: The guide emphasizes using real-life situations and the students' own experiences as the starting point for language development.

The guide typically breaks down the curriculum into four key pillars:
Speaking and Listening: Focused on oral communication, storytelling, and active participation in discussions.
Writing: Moving from "invented spelling" to standard orthography, including creative writing and text production.
Reading: Developing reading fluency and literary appreciation.
Language Reflection: A modern alternative to traditional grammar lessons, where students investigate how language works through discovery. Where to Find the 15th Edition

Horst Bartnitzky’s "Sprachunterricht heute" (15th ed., 2011) is a standard, action-oriented text in German pedagogy that bridges theory with practical classroom applications for primary education .
